Embalming, Ch. 18 || with 100% Errorless Answers.
leave them in place correct answers what should you do with procurement sutures

cauterant correct answers what should you use on the affected area of a skin donor

heart, kidney, liver, lungs, pancreas correct answers List the organs which can be transplanted

Bone, cornea, heart valves, sclera, skin, tendons, veins correct answers list the tissues which can
be transplanted

midline from base of the neck to base of the sternum correct answers where will a procurement
incision be located if the heart, lungs, or both have been removed

midline from base of sternum to pubic bone or a t incision correct answers where will a
procurement incision be located if the liver, kidneys, or small bowel have been removed

midline from base of neck to pubic bone correct answers where will a procurement incision be
located if a full recovery has been done

heparin correct answers this drug is commonly used prior to the removal of a donated organ to
keep blood from clotting

better drainage correct answers what is an advantage of a body that has been treated with heparin

livor mortis & postmortem stain correct answers what are the disadvantages of a body that has
been treated with heparin

swelling or distension correct answers what are the most common problems associated with eye
enucleation

restricted cervical correct answers what type of injection should you perform on a body with eye
enucleation

no correct answers should you use preinjection fluid on bodies with eye enucleation

strong correct answers what type of solution should you use on a body with eye enucleation

excessive manipulation of the eyelids correct answers what should you avoid to reduce the
possibility of swelling on a body with eye enucleation

remove packing from the eye correct answers what is the first step to treating a head with eye
enucleation

loosely fill it with cotton soaked in autopsy gel correct answers enucleation: what should you do
with the orbital cavity once you have removed the initial packing from the eye
